    Description

    The Amazon Worldwide (WW) Operations Finance Team is looking for a talented, customer service obsessed, resourceful and self-motivated Executive Assistant to help support two (2) Finance Directors in a fast paced environment. This role requires an in office presence five (5) days a week in our Arlington, VA location.

    You will possess a keen sense of urgency and demonstrate the capacity to execute assignments autonomously with sound judgment. Essential qualities include meticulous attention to detail, ability to respond effectively using exceptional writing and editing proficiency, proven experience in event planning and building mechanisms to create efficiency.

    This role requires a strong sense of ownership, composure under pressure, customer-centric orientation, and consistent adherence to deadlines. You will have superior organizational and tracking abilities, and agility in rapidly shifting priorities.

    Of paramount importance is a high degree of integrity and discretion in managing confidential information, coupled with consummate professionalism when interacting with stakeholders both internally and externally.

    This role demands a strong sense of urgency and the ability to work independently on assignments with sound judgment. The candidate will be a detail oriented, experienced planner with the demonstrated ability to respond effectively and efficiently while maintaining flexibility. The candidate will have a sense of management of oneself and ability to make decisions independently while striving to be customer-service oriented under tight deadlines. Having great organization skills and the ability to switch gears at a moment's notice will ensure success.

    Key job responsibilities

    Responsibilities (including but not limited to):

    • Complex calendar management and scheduling of internal and external meetings
    • Management of domestic and international travel
    • Management of procurement and expenses
    • Management of key team activities (such as staff meeting agendas, all-hands meetings, supply ordering, etc.)
    • Drive and track completion of key deliverables; follow up on overdue items and projects as needed
    • Organize, prioritize and manage time-sensitive, confidential information; ensure any action items are executed
    • Work closely with leadership team and other Executives Assistants to provide support to the organization
    • Management of team space, including moves and reconfiguration
    • Project/program management: Support cyclical operational planning process, business planning, and performance review cycles

    It’s Always Day 1
    At Amazon, it’s always “Day 1.” Now, what does this mean and why does it matter? It means that our approach remains the same as it was on Amazon’s very first day – to make smart, fast decisions, stay nimble, invent, and stay focused on delighting our customers. In our 2016 shareholder letter, Amazon CEO Jeff Bezos shared his thoughts on how to keep up a Day 1 company mindset. “Staying in Day 1 requires you to experiment patiently, accept failures, plant seeds, protect saplings, and double down when you see customer delight,” he wrote. “A customer-obsessed culture best creates the conditions where all of that can happen.” You can read the full letter here
